SAVE THE DATE – Workshop for potential beneficiaries of standard projects
A bilingual information workshop will be organised to support applicants to prepare good quality applications that are in line with the programme rules on 5 December 2024, in Zalaegerszeg, Hungary.

LÉLEGEZZÜNK EGYÜTT! / DIHAJMO SKUPAJ!
The municipalities of Selnica ob Drava and the Hungarian Zalakaros jointly prepared the cross-border project DIHAJMO! / LÉLEGEZZÜNK!, which was financially supported by the European Union within the framework of the Interreg programme Slovenia - Hungary.
Folk Music Show: Common folk music – joint performances
The project Folk Music Show started on 1 April 2024 and the projectpartners have realised the planned two full-day folk music events until the end of May.
Crafts4Future workshops
In March, the activities of a small-scale project within the framework of the Interreg Programme Slovenia-Hungary entitled Preserving handicraft heritage in the border area of Slovenia and Hungary, acronym Crafts4Future, started.
